Clanton's Cafe

319 E Illinois Ave, Vinita, OK 74301

Clanton's Cafe is the oldest continuously family-owned restaurant on Route 66, founded in 1927 in Vinita, Oklahoma. Famous for its chicken fried steak and calf fries, it is a nostalgic stop for truckers traveling I-44 (the Will Rogers Turnpike) between Tulsa and Joplin.
